Sardinia: Luxury versus Affordable

Sardinia is an Island in the Mediterranean situated directly under the Island of Corsica. It is an Italian island and is second largest only to Sicily. Although Italian, it is geographically not that close but rather its neighbours are French, Tunisian and Spanish! This diverse island is famous for its stunning beaches and boasts 1,150 miles of coastline. In the north of the Island there are some powder white soft sand beaches and you could be forgiven for thinking you have arrived in the Caribbean!

This Island, although not quite so well known to us here in the UK, is very popular with Italian holidaymakers and is therefore best avoided during the months of July and August. We visited in late September when many of the small towns and villages were almost deserted, and, in some cases, we were the only people on the beach, absolutely perfect! There are mountains through the centre of the island, with the highest peak reaching over 1,800 metres. There are dramatic cliffs that fall away into the sea and some beautiful drives that keep you on the edge of your seat. You can, of course, walk the coastal paths or ramble through alpine forests, if that is your thing.

Luxury Sardinia

For this option we have chosen The Hotel Marinedda Thalasso & SPA. It is situated in an historic fishing village overlooking the north-west coast of Sardinia on the Costa Rossa. This 5* hotel offers a very high standard of accommodation with views out over the Golfo dell’Asinara. It boasts a Spa centre which offers wellness packages designed especially for couples. The most luxurious room on offer is the President Suite with double bed and adjoining sitting room with two single sofa beds. It has a large veranda overlooking the sea. For a week in mid-September, the cost of this suite, including breakfast, brunch and dinner, is €4,452.

Affordable Sardinia

We have found a beautiful little apartment at the Residence Stella Di Gallura, 500 yards from the La Caletta beach in Porto Rotondo. The apartments are set in a garden complete with swimming pool and a traditional restaurant, which gets fantastic reviews. A one bedroom apartment for two people is £455 for a week in September and £594 for four people. This seems excellent value for money considering its amenities and location.
